WebCut Romaine lettuce, however, is commonly packaged in low O 2 (<1%) and high CO 2 (7-10%) atmospheres because these conditions control browning on the cut surfaces. On salad pieces, cut surface browning occurs more rapidly and more extensively than do symptoms of brown stain caused by CO 2 .
